The IF function is a built-in function in Excel that is categorized as a Logical Function. The IF statement can have two results. The first result is if your comparison is True, the second if your comparison is False. The syntax of an Excel IF statement is: IF(logictest, valueif true, valueiffalse). You can directly compare dates using logical operators (<, >, etc.). Excel has built-in type coercion which lets you do things without being super rigorous about data types. In Microsoft Excel, when you use the logical functions AND and/or OR inside a SUM IF statement to test a range for more than one condition, it may not work as expected.

A nested IF statement provides complex testing functionality. You can nest up to 7 If statements to create complex tests. If the first logicaltest is FALSE, the second IF statement is evaluated, and so on. A non-numeric (BOOLEAN) value is coerced into a numeric value by Excel by using arithmetic operations.

Specifically, your logical test in IF statements: Excel cant evaluate a logical test like "C7B78", so it will return FALSE every time. Each IF statement needs to be carefully "nested" inside another so that the logic is correct. The logicaltest is a value or logical expression that can be evaluated as TRUE or FALSE. The valueiftrue is the value to return when logicaltest evaluates to TRUE.